The game uses a behind-the-car racing view and sends players through a set of point-to-point and lap-style tracks across the United States. Core controls focus on steering, acceleration, and braking, with selectable transmission options in some versions. Races reward keeping momentum, avoiding walls, and using aggressive driving to pass rivals. Progress is tied to clearing courses and advancing to tougher tracks.

Brake before sharp turns rather than during them, and try to exit corners as smoothly as possible to preserve speed. Use the width of the road to set up a cleaner racing line, and avoid bouncing off guardrails. On straight sections, build a lead before the next technical area. Winning is more about consistency than risky overtakes.

About Cruis'n USA

Cruis'n USA is a 1996 Nintendo 64 arcade, racing game, developed by Midway and published by Midway. Cruis'n USA is an arcade-style racing game developed and published by Midway. Players race licensed American muscle cars across courses inspired by famous U.S. landmarks and regions. Built around fast pacing, simple controls, and exaggerated collisions, it became one of the most recognizable early Nintendo 64 racing titles.
